Output f84c38c28c16f412f58558196b72aa2d9fd95162b6c2ad19035c6e112ba15ca3:0

value
512672
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3fe8baaf67654421b8cb8168d3cc444e4e9f2638 OP_EQUALVERIFY OP_CHECKSIG
address
16pvNPzESXdvUfWoevkQ32rbQERG5toaBw
transaction
f84c38c28c16f412f58558196b72aa2d9fd95162b6c2ad19035c6e112ba15ca3
spent
true